Detailed line-by-line tax calculation for a Software Quality Assurance Analysts and Testers earning $83,970 in Kansas (single filer, standard deduction).
| Tax Component | Annual Amount | Effective Rate |
|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ary (Median) | $83,970 | — |
| Federal Income Tax | -$10,314 | 12.3% |
| Kansas State Income Tax | -$4,328 | 5.2% |
| Social Security (OASDI) | -$5,206 | 6.2% |
| Medicare | -$1,217 | 1.5% |
| Total Taxes | -$21,066 | 25.1% |
| Take-Home Pay | $62,903 | 74.9% |

We start with the 2024 BLS median salary of $83,970 for Software Quality Assurance Analysts and Testers in Kansas, then subtract: federal income tax using 2024 IRS brackets ($14,600 standard deduction), Kansas state income tax (progressive (up to 5.7%)), Social Security (6.2% up to $168,600), and Medicare (1.45%). The result — $62,903/yr — does not include local taxes, pre-tax deductions (401k, HSA), or tax credits.
This estimate assumes a single filer using the 2024 standard deduction ($14,600), with W-2 employment income only. It does not account for: itemized deductions, tax credits (e.g. earned income credit, child tax credit), local/city taxes, pre-tax contributions (401k, HSA, FSA), self-employment tax, or additional income sources.
